--- license: other base_model: SwissNeuron/Qwen3.8-27B-SwissNeuron-Derisked pipeline_tag: image-text-to-text library_name: transformers tags: - qwen3.8 - qwen3_5 - fp8 - compressed-tensors - multimodal - vision - reasoning - image-text-to-text - swissneuron --- # Qwen3.8-27B-SwissNeuron-Derisked-FP8 FP8 dynamic quantization of [SwissNeuron/Qwen3.8-27B-SwissNeuron-Derisked](https://huggingface.co/SwissNeuron/Qwen3.8-27B-SwissNeuron-Derisked). - Source revision: repaired direct-answer SFT + fresh latest-SFT DWM α=0.1 - Format: compressed-tensors W8A8 FP8 dynamic - Weight quantization: static FP8 - Activation quantization: dynamic per-token FP8 - Gated-DeltaNet linear-attention modules, vision tower, MTP draft head, embeddings, and LM head remain BF16 for compatibility and stability - Active config retains factor-4 YaRN to 1,048,576 tokens; validate extreme-context quality for your workload ## Runtime Use a current vLLM/Transformers stack with Qwen3.8 (`Qwen3_5ForConditionalGeneration`) and compressed-tensors support. FP8 compute requires recent NVIDIA GPUs; Hopper, Ada, and Blackwell are suitable. ```bash vllm serve SwissNeuron/Qwen3.8-27B-SwissNeuron-Derisked-FP8 \ --tensor-parallel-size 1 \ --trust-remote-code ``` ## Thinking modes The repaired checkpoint supports both modes through the included chat template: ```python tokenizer.apply_chat_template(messages, enable_thinking=True, add_generation_prompt=True) ``` Set `enable_thinking=False` for lower-latency direct answers. ## Limitations This is a quantized derivative. Re-evaluate critical workloads and long-context retrieval rather than assuming BF16 parity. The underlying model and release notes are documented in the source repository.
